Warning:
• Do not refreeze thawed milk.
• Do not mix fresh breast milk with thawed milk.
Note:
• Fresh breast milk should be stored in refrigerator or freezer.
• Be sure to date the milk for storage. Mild should be stored in a refrigerator
for no longer than 48 hours and the freezer for no longer than 3 months.
• When freezing, maximum milk volume should be ¾ of storage bottle. Milk
can expand during freezing.
Preparing Breast Milk
• If the milk is refrigerated, put the milk container in warm water to heat the
milk. Shake the container to warm the milk through.
• If the milk is frozen, defrost in the refrigerator 24 hours prior to using. Once
defrosted, warm it as refrigerated milk.
Using milk heater:
Turn on milk heater and set it to 40
0
C. Put milk container into heater.
Layers of liquid may for when using frozen milk. This is normal. Please shake
bottle well before feeding.
Warning:
• Do not heat thawed milk again.
• Do not use microwave oven to defrost breast milk.
• Do not heat milk with boiling water.
• If hot water is used to heat milk, please try milk temperature before
feeding.
